#B74BFE Hex Color Code

#B74BFE

The Hexadecimal Color #B74BFE is a contrast shade of Medium Orchid. #B74BFE RGB value is rgb(183, 75, 254). RGB Color Model of #B74BFE consists of 71% red, 29% green and 99% blue. HSL color Mode of #B74BFE has 276°(degrees) Hue, 99% Saturation and 65% Lightness. #B74BFE color has an wavelength of 446.22222n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B74BFE is #CC66F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B74BFE is #B4F. The Closest Color to #B74BFE is #BA55D3. Official Name of #B74BFE Hex Code is Lavender.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B74BFE is 28 Cyan 70 Magenta 0 Yellow 0 Black and #B74BFE CMY is 28, 70,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B74BFE is hsl(276,99,65,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(276, 70, 100).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B74BFE is 39.93, 22.26, 95.94.
Hex8 Value of #B74BFE is #B74BFEFF. Decimal Value of #B74BFE is 12012542 and Octal Value of #B74BFE is 55645776. Binary Value of #B74BFE is 10110111, 1001011, 11111110 and Android of #B74BFE is 4290202622 / 0xffb74bfe.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B74BFE is 0.253, 0.141, 0.141 and YIQ Color Space of #B74BFE is 127.698, 6.8445, 78.5468.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B74BFE is 23.24, 10.28, 94.77.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B74BFE is 54.3, 71.45, -70.53.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B74BFE is 54.3, 30.75, -116.87.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B74BFE is 54.3, 100.4, 315.37. Hunter Lab variable of #B74BFE is 47.18, 68.5, -87.54.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B74BFE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
